Angular 刷新数据:让你的应用保持活力

Angular作为一款功能强大的前端框架,为我们构建动态、交互式的Web应用提供了强大的工具。在实际开发过程中,我们经常需要根据用户操作、服务器数据变化等因素,动态更新页面上的数据,以保持应用的实时性和交互性。这便是Angular数据刷新的核心所在。

本文将深入浅出地探讨Angular数据刷新的常见方法、原理以及最佳实践,帮助您掌握Angular数据刷新的技巧,让您的应用保持活力,为用户提供更流畅、更便捷的体验。

一、Angular数据刷新的常见方法

Angular提供了多种方法来实现数据刷新,根据不同的场景和需求,我们可以选择最合适的方案:

手动更新

最直接的方法是手动更新数据。当数据发生变化时,我们可以直接修改组件中的数据属性,并使用bservable是Angular中用于处理异步操作的强大工具。我们可以使用bservable来监 新加坡电话号码 听数据变化,并在数据发生变化时更新视图。asyn管道可以方便地将bservable与模板绑定,实现数据自动更新。方法通知Angular进行变更检测,从而更新视图。

Subjet和BehavirSubjet都是bservable的子类,它们可以用来实现数据共享和数据更新。Subjet可以用来发布事件,通知订阅者数据发生变化;BehavirSubjet则可以存储最新值,并将其作为初始值提供给新订阅者。

电话号码清单

二、Angular数据刷新的原理

Angular数据刷新基于变更检测机制。当组件中的数 沙特阿拉伯电话号码列表 据发生变化时,Angular会自动检测数据变化,并更新视图。

Angular变更检测的原理如下:

脏检查(Dirtyheking):Angular会定期检查组件中的数据是否发生变化。如果数据发生变化,则更新视图。
事件监听(EventListening):Angular会监听D事件、用户输入事件等,并在事件触发时进行变更检测。
异步操作(Asynperatins):Angular会监听异步操作,例如HTTP请求、定时器等等,并在异步操作完成后进行变更检测。
三、Angular数据刷新的最佳实践

为了提高Angular应用的性能和效率,在进行数据刷新时,需要注意以下最佳实践:

 

Leave a comment

Your email address will not be published. Required fields are marked *